Delta SkyMiles Platinum Credit Card Review

Key Takeaways

If you fly Delta annually with a companion, the Delta SkyMiles Platinum card can be a solid choice. It currently offers a 60,000-mile sign-up bonus, although past offers have reached 90,000 miles, so waiting for a higher bonus might be advantageous. Even if you can't wait, the benefits can easily offset the $350 annual fee.

These perks include a yearly companion certificate valid for a main cabin flight within the United States, Mexico, the Caribbean, or Central America. You'll also receive several statement credits. If you fly Delta at least once a year with someone else, this card may quickly justify its cost.

Why This Card Could Be Right For You

The Delta SkyMiles Platinum card is well-suited for people who fly Delta once or twice per year, especially if they travel with a companion. Its standout feature is an annual companion certificate good for a main cabin flight within the U.S., Mexico, the Caribbean, or Central America. The current 60,000-mile bonus can cover one or two round-trip flights, depending on the route, although previous offers have been as high as 90,000 miles. The $350 annual fee is offset by the companion certificate and additional credits, such as:

  • $120 in annual rideshare credits
  • A $150 Delta Stay credit
  • $120 in Resy credits
  • A free checked bag
  • Global Entry or TSA PreCheck credit
  • Hertz 5 Star status
  • 15% savings on award travel booked with miles

If you fly Delta once or twice a year with a partner, friend, or colleague, this card can deliver substantial ongoing value.

When The Usual Advice Doesn't Apply

Here are some exceptions where the card might not be good for you:

  • If you fly Delta more than a few times per year, you might get more value from the higher-fee Delta SkyMiles Reserve card.
  • If you usually fly alone, the companion certificate might not be worth the cost.

How The Delta SkyMiles Platinum Credit Card Fits In The Delta SkyMiles Ecosystem

Of American Express’s four Delta-branded personal credit cards, Delta SkyMiles Platinum strikes a good balance of perks for its $350 annual fee. It’s ideal if you fly Delta once or twice a year with another person. If you fly more often or prefer First Class or Comfort+, the Delta SkyMiles Reserve card has more benefits but carries a $650 annual fee.

If you’re an infrequent Delta flyer, consider the Delta SkyMiles Gold card. Its $150 annual fee is waived in the first year, and even though its sign-up bonus is currently 50,000 miles (previously as high as 80,000), it may still be enough if you only fly Delta occasionally. For a no-fee option, the Delta SkyMiles Blue card has minimal perks but can be a good downgrade path if you want to avoid annual fees without closing your account.

Delta SkyMiles Platinum Application Rules

Amex will decline your application if you already have 4 credit cards (not charge) and apply for a fifth

You'll be declined if you apply for a fourth Amex card in 90 days

Card approval not subject to 5-personal-cards-in-24-months rule

Amex allows only 1 bonus per specific card per lifetime (yours or that version of the card)
